Variations: Glashntinhe
In Manx folklore the pale grey Cabyll-Ushtey ("Water horse") is a species of water horse similar to the Scottish Each-uisge, although not as injurious. Occasionally this fairy animal will prey upon cattle and humans alike, ripping them to pieces, stampede horse herds, steal children. the Cabyll-Ushtey also has the ability to shape-shift into a handsome young man.
